I think she's relatively amovey (if you don't go for lots of starport units). I also think she's not that hard carry. I don't think I failed many missions when grinding other recent commanders to lev15, but have had few issues now if ally doesn't do much. Specially the scourge/bane/ling/aberration combination seems overwhelming sometimes as she doesn't have very good anti ground aoe (edit: tbh I forgot about shotgun mode when I faced this so nvm:>), except the too expensive top panel option. And just in general dmg output and ability to max her armies due to long cooldowns is slow.

I "only" got her to lev10 so maybe opinions still change with upcoming upgrades. As it is she's not as strong by default as Aba/Alarak were when they were introduced. I also haven't found reason to use assault mode as clearing mid level enemies from afar with snipe seems too important to miss. Cooldown seems too long now, maybe it feels OK @ lev15.

I dislike how costly the top panel options are. I'd like the griffin (1000 minerals one) getting its dmg reduced by 50% and price as well. You rarely have 1k minerals laying around when the "oh shit" situation comes. It also feels such waste to use it before you're maxed even when you have the money.

Enjoying general macro play, she's not my cup of tea really. I keep looking to make more units 5 times before I'm allowed to. And as you don't get punished for missing a cycle due to 2 charges, she seems like 0 macro commander. I guess that's OK, if you go for heavier micro army with a lot of casters.
